## Deployment

PortionWise is the recipe-scaling calculator behind the customer-facing cooking app. It deploys as a single container to the shared app cluster; releases are promoted from staging after the scaling test suite passes. Support should know that unit-conversion tables are baked into the image, so fixes require a redeploy. The service starts with the following configuration values.

config for kafof-bawef:
holath:
  log_level: debug
  metrics_host: metrics.holath.qorvelsys.internal
  pin: 2191
  pool_size: 32

**Audit item 14: Cold storage bucket archival.** Verify that all Glacierline buckets older than 18 months have been moved to the frozen tier, that lifecycle rules in the Permafrost console match the retention matrix, and that checksums were recorded before and after transfer. Do not delete source objects until the verification report is signed. Any mismatch must be logged in the audit ledger within 48 hours. The person accountable for this item is named below.

named custodian: Zorok Briir Novvan

Meeting Notes — Receiving Site

Reviewed the printed labels for the Alderwyn Gallery opening at the Strathmere Museum annex. All forty-two labels proofed and approved; packed flat in two archival folders with stiffeners. Humidity-sensitive inks, so keep them out of direct sun during transit. Delivery expected Tuesday morning. The courier hand-over instruction agreed in the meeting follows below.

handover note for bajog-tawig: the lamion quenael courier leaves the wendor ledger at gate 1289 under passcode 760784